Activities: Boating in the reservoir is a must-do activity for every visitor. Explore the Lion Safari Park where you can see lions in a natural habitat. Visit the Crocodile Park to see various species of these ancient reptiles. Trekking to the nearby hills provides a thrill for adventure seekers. Photography of the dam structure and the lake is highly popular. Children can enjoy the designated park area with swings and slides. Birdwatching near the reservoir banks reveals many tropical species. Enjoy a peaceful walk across the dam bridge for scenic views. Visit the Deer Park to see spotted deer and sambar in enclosures. Exploring the Elephant Rehabilitation Centre nearby is a soul-warming experience. ...

Architecture:
The dam is a classic gravity structure built using rubble masonry and concrete. It measures approximately 294 meters in length and stands at a height of 38 meters above the foundation. The spillway is designed to handle heavy monsoon discharge with precision. Its design reflects the mid-century ...The dam is a classic gravity structure built using rubble masonry and concrete. Health & Safety: Avoid swimming in the reservoir due to crocodiles.
Packing: Carry water, sunscreen, and comfortable walking shoes.
Cash: ATMs are available in Neyyattinkara town, about 10 KMS away.
